Why is my car battery cranking so slow?

A slow engine crank is often a sign of a poor battery. If your battery is older than four years old, it may be time to replace it. Extreme temperatures , such as the heat, can cause the battery fluid to evaporate. This can, in turn, damage the battery’s internal components.

When replacing a car battery, should it match the group size?

Before the battery is replaced, most auto stores will test your battery to see if it needs to be replaced or recharged. This testing should be free at most places. When the battery is replaced, it should match the manufacturer’s recommended group size for the make and model.

What is a MTP 65 battery?

The MTP-65 battery is a traditional flooded battery where you’d have to add water to increase their lifetime. It has removable caps for the reason. With cold-cranking amps of 750, the battery is well suitable for cold climates to moderate climates.

How many amps does a MT 34 battery have?

If a good starting battery is what you need, MT-34 is your pick. Continuing with the specifications, the battery has around 120 minutes of reserve capacity at 25 amps which gives you powerful startups in all weather conditions. Another advantage is maintenance-free and also recharges quickly.
